// TestMultiEventSyncerRPCCount instruments the RPC calls
// MultiEventSyncer.Sync issues when it has to fetch logs for N active
// EventTriggerRegisteredEvent rows over one sync range.
//
// The pre-S2 code path issues one FilterLogs per active trigger (N calls per
// range); the post-S2 code path unions all triggers' (address, topic[0])
// criteria into a single combined FilterLogs. This test does not assert
// specific numbers; it t.Logs the counts so the same test file compiled on
// both branches produces a clean before/after comparison.
//
// To keep the test source portable across the S2 interface change on
// EventProcessor, only TriggerProcessor is registered. That is where the
// bulk of the reduction lives anyway (registry processor issued one call in
// both variants).

// TestEventSyncerRPCCount instruments the RPC calls the EventSyncer issues
// when it is asked to sync a range of blocks that contain events matching
// several registered EventTypes. The test does not assert exact numbers;
// instead it prints them via t.Log for before/after comparison across the B4
// optimization commit.
//
// Setup:
// - Deploys the Emitter contract on a simulated backend fronted by a
// JSON-RPC counting proxy.
// - Registers five EventTypes on the same contract (Two, Four, Five, Six,
// SingleIdx).
// - Commits enough blocks that at least one of every event type has been
// emitted.
// - Resets the counter, then runs EventSyncer.Start and drains Next() until
// the syncer has caught up to the tip.
// - Logs the counts of the JSON-RPC methods the syncer issued during that
// drain.
